The Screwtape Letters is a creative collection of letters that were sent by one of the "upper management" demons of Hell to a "lower-level" employee tasked with tempting a particular human, so as to win a soul for the Devil. What is appealing about this book is the way in which Christianity, God and humanity are portrayed. God is referenced as "the Enemy", while Humanity is both despised - out of jealousy - and admired by the demons.
